Skip to main content

其他问题

一、turtle依赖包使用说明

由于 turtle 依赖交互式 UI 渲染,目前暂不支持该依赖包的使用。

二、预览地址预测方法

预览地址由空间Key、UrlToken、端口号及域名组成,可通过以下格式访问环境变量进行预测:

${X_IDE_SPACE_KEY}-${PORT}.${region}.cloudstudio.club

若需查询当前应用的具体环境变量,可通过echo命令快速获取:

echo ${X_IDE_SPACE_KEY}-${PORT}.${region}.cloudstudio.club

三、端口与转发相关支持说明

(一)是否支持TCP和UDP端口转发?

目前暂不支持TCP和UDP端口的转发。

(二)是否支持WebSocket转发?

支持WebSocket转发,需注意:客户端需通过wss://协议进行连接。

(三)什么类型的代理支持预览转发?

CloudStudio 提供 HTTPS 网关,仅支持代理工作空间内部的非 HTTPS 服务;若为 HTTPS 服务,则无法代理。

四、关于平台是否支持 SSH 的说明

(一)是否支持 SSH?

目前平台暂时不支持直接的 SSH 连接

若您有远程访问需求且愿意自行探索配置,可通过以下方式实现类似功能,核心思路为 “安装 SSH 服务 + 网络穿透”

五、解决 Vite 验证问题

问题

在使用 Vite 开发时,可能会遇到前端页面无法正常访问的情况,如下图所示:

典型错误表现​:

  • 页面显示 "Blocked request" 错误提示
  • 控制台报错:该主机未被允许访问
  • Vite 服务正常启动,但网络请求被阻止

解决方案​

vite.config.js 中,我们推荐使用以下配置:

server: {
host: true, // 启用外部访问
port: 3000, // 默认服务端口
strictPort: false // 自动处理端口占用
// 注意:allowedHosts 字段无需配置
}

重要提示:

  • 已内置此问题的完整修复,通常无需任何额外配置
  • 如果手动配置了 allowedHosts 字段,自定义配置具有最高优先级
  • 推荐使用默认配置,无需添加 allowedHosts